Muted Response to Bernie Sanders at South Carolina Church


WEST COLUMBIA, S.C. — The problem began as soon as Bernie Sanders walked into the dining room of the revered, and predominantly black, Brookland Baptist Church. Instead of flocking to him, as people do at his large college rallies, many of church’s 780 members looked up for a moment, then quietly went back to eating their Sunday feast — unmoved as Mr. Sanders, the Democratic senator from Vermont, tried to work the room.

He made remarks at a microphone next to a buffet table offering chicken, collard greens and dinner rolls. The line at the table kept moving as Mr. Sanders and Benjamin T. Jealous, a former N.A.A.C.P. president, spoke. The Brookland Baptist congregation proved to be a tough crowd.

“We have in America today a broken criminal justice system,” Mr. Sanders said, pausing briefly after this line from his stump speech, which is usually met with applause. Here it garnered very little.

His visit underscored Mr. Sanders’s difficulty in strengthening his support among black voters in South Carolina, who make up more than half of registered Democrats heading into the state primary this Saturday. While some applauded politely as he offered now-familiar lines about racial discrimination, the loudest claps came when he talked about President Obama.

Unions Say a Majority of Their Members Support Hillary Clinton

In an effort to dispute what they say is a false narrative that union voters are closely split between Hillary Clinton and Senator Bernie Sanders of Vermont, a group of more than 20 unions representing more than 10 million workers released a statement on Monday reaffirming support for Mrs. Clinton.
“Secretary Clinton has proven herself as the fighter and champion working people and their families need in the White House,” says the statement, which was embraced by several large unions, including the American Federation of State, County, and Municipal Employees, the American Federation of Teachers ,and the Service Employees International Union. “That is why, of all unions endorsing a candidate in the Democratic primary, the vast majority of the membership in these unions has endorsed her.”

GREENVILLE, S.C. — The term ‘socialist’ once was used as an epithet in American politics. Perhaps no more.

In a year in which Bernie Sanders, a self-described ‘Democratic Socialist,’ is running a competitive primary campaign for the White House, a new survey finds that a healthy portion of Democratic primary voters are favorably inclined toward socialism.

Nearly six-in-ten Democratic primary voters believe socialism has a 'positive impact on society,' according to polling conducted this month for the right-leaning issue advocacy group American Action Network and provided to POLITICO.

Democratic voters in every age group, every gender, and every race view socialism favorably, according to the early February telephone poll of 1,000 likely Democratic primary voters fielded by Republican firm OnMessage Inc. and commissioned by AAN, which is tied to the Congressional Leadership Fund super PAC dedicated to House Republicans. And among people 45 and under — a group that has helped power Sanders’ primary performances — the ideology is preferred to capitalism by a margin of 46 percent to 19 percent.

The polling made a specific point not to mention Sanders or Democratic front-runner Hillary Clinton, according to AAN president Mike Shields, as part of an effort to avoid findings that simply reflect that race. Instead, he said, it was inspired by a pair of television interviews in which Democratic Party chairwoman Debbie Wasserman Schultz was pressed on the difference between a Democrat and a Socialist.
